Instrumentation, OP Amps, Buffer Amps Texas Instruments LMH6658MAX Overview

The Texas Instruments LMH6658MAX is a state-of-the-art voltage feedback amplifier that falls within the category of Instrumentation, Operational Amplifiers, and Buffer Amplifiers. This IC is designed to deliver high-speed performance with a dual circuit configuration, housed in an 8-SOIC package. The LMH6658MAX is an ideal choice for applications requiring low distortion and high slew rate, ensuring superior signal fidelity and bandwidth efficiency. With its robust design, the LMH6658MAX enhances system reliability and functionality, making it a prime selection for critical signal processing tasks.

LMH6658MAX Features

This integrated circuit boasts a slew rate of 600 V/µs and a wide bandwidth up to 230 MHz, which are critical in high-frequency signal applications. The LMH6658MAX also features a low input noise and low harmonic distortion, enhancing overall system performance. Its dual supply voltage ranges from ±2.5V to ±5.5V, offering versatility in different electronic circuit configurations.

LMH6658MAX Applications

  • Active Filters: The LMH6658MAX can be used in designing active filters for noise reduction in audio and data communication systems, improving signal clarity and performance.
  • Data Acquisition Systems: Its high slew rate and bandwidth make it suitable for high-speed data acquisition systems, ensuring accurate and rapid capture of data.
  • Test Equipment: Utilized in the development of test equipment where precise signal amplification is necessary to measure varying voltages accurately.
  • Medical Imaging: In medical imaging systems, the LMH6658MAX helps in enhancing image quality by amplifying small signals in a noisy environment.
